Stop proposed cuts to UK funding for clean water and sanitation overseas aid
Closed
90 signatures
What the petition asks
Clean water is the basis of an empowered life. We are asking the Government to publicly commit to maintaining the UK's existing spending commitments on clean water and sanitation in overseas aid budgets.
Clean water is the basis of an empowered life. It is the foundation of economic, social and physical development in every country on earth. It is also essential at both home and abroad to fighting the spread infectious diseases such as Covid-19. To propose cuts to this area of budget at a time of global pandemic condemns the world's most vulnerable people to even greater challenges, when it is our obligation to help.
